Output 80d5628dcaf8b40e3a7dd458c05943e15652b4ce6567ad69513c5e62f77f03ab:2
- value
- 105311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7edb424bdbd89ab0f25ebbbc39388fcf01383217 OP_EQUAL
- address
- 3DFmj6SpjBgwuKbym3LHucmPpEwz7p12fn
- transaction
- 80d5628dcaf8b40e3a7dd458c05943e15652b4ce6567ad69513c5e62f77f03ab
- confirmations
- 318404
- spent
- true